Lowering The Cost Of Motorcycle Insurance For Students

2010-11-22

Shopping for student motorcycle insurance can be an intimidating venture. Motorcycles are statistically more dangerous than other types of automobiles so rates are already high. When that is coupled with the inexperience of a young rider and the insurance costs for students can start rising pretty quickly. Fortunately, there are some simple steps that students can take to help lower the cost of their motorcycle insurance.

An effective way to lower insurance costs for students is to have them take a motorcycle training course. These are typically administered by the state's Department of Public Safety. They have classes designed for beginners that show new riders the basics such as how to operate a motorcycle, how to avoid perilous situations, what sort of protective gear is necessary and how to deal with dangerous situations should you find yourself in one. The teachers are all professionally trained and classes are very affordable. For a one-time fee, you can typically save between 10 and 15 percent on your student motorcycle insurance costs.

Another way to lowering insurance costs for students would be to increase the cost of the deductible. If the rider does find themselves in a situation in which they have to file a claim, the amount out of pocket becomes higher but you do save money each month that you avoid any accidents. This may not be the best route for a brand new rider but it is an option that is particularly attractive to experienced young riders who are confident in their riding abilities.

The type of bike that a young rider rides can also affect the cost of their motorcycle insurance. Because custom bikes are most often used for off road activity that is viewed by insurance companies as highly accident prone, these types of bikes are going to require more expensive insurance. It's also important to note that the insurance premium will most likely not cover certain parts or accessories in custom bikes, particularly the more expensive ones. So, be very careful when selecting a policy and be sure to review it thoroughly to make sure it covers everything you need to be covered.

If a young rider can prove to an insurance company that they keep their motorcycle stored in a garage or some other type of secure storage space, the provider may offer a discount. This is because motorcycles are easy and frequent targets for vandalism and insurance carriers view that as extra risk that they may have to pay for. But by eliminating as much risk for the insurance company as possible, you may be offered discounts that other student riders would not receive otherwise.
